Engagement with community on Former British Timken Works

17
Jul

In line with WNDC’s commitment to public consultation and to ensuring that new development meets the Government’s design quality and environmental performance standards, a public exhibition is being held by WNDC at the Duston Library and Community Centre building between Monday 21 July and Friday 8 August 2008.

The exhibition will showcase the design guide and environmental standards for the proposed employment developments on the former British Timken Works in Duston.

Stephen Kelly, WNDC’s Director of Planning and Development, said: “These documents are part of our continued commitment to delivering a high quality sustainable development on this site. WNDC looks forward, through this exhibition, to the community’s continuing participation with us in realizing this objective.”

The developer, Wilson Bowden Developments, have submitted details on landscaping, materials, ecology, transport that will be available to view at the exhibition. Planning officers from WNDC will also be available to answer questions on Thursday, 24 July at 10.00 – 13.00, Friday, 25 July at 15.00 – 18.00 and Saturday, 26 July at 10.00 – 13.00. Comments need to be received by WNDC by Monday, 11 August.
